Oscillometric blood pressure measurement
Brabencová, Klára ; Harabiš, Vratislav (referee) ; Slávik, Vladimír (advisor)
The aim of my work is to propose a meter of blood pressure with oscillometric method using LabView software. To determine systolic and diastolic blood pressure is used detect the maximum oscillation of the envelope signal. The maximum oscillation corresponding to a mean arterial pressure and this value is then calculate systolic and diastolic pressure. In the programming environment of LabVIEW is the signal from the pressure sensor and cuff over the LabPro processed and are calculated limits of arterial pressure.

Statistical properties of ultrasound images in contrast mode
Věžníková, Romana ; Kolář, Radim (referee) ; Slávik, Vladimír (advisor)
The bachelor’s thesis is focused on properties of ultrasound images in contrast mode. First of all it describes the basic properties of ultrasound, the way in which the ultrasonic signals are generated, the parameters of ultrasound and ultrasonic imaging modes. Next part deals with harmonic and contrast imaging modes. This part explains principles of these modes as well as the usage of contrast agents and artefacts connected with ultrasound imaging in contrast mode. The thesis also shows the approximation of the amplitude probability density function of ultrasonic images and description of its single models, out of which is chosen the RiIG model (Rician Inverse Gaussian distribution) for approximation of ultrasound images in this case. To gain parameters of amplitude probability density function from ultrasonic data in contrast imaging mode is made the application using Matlab programming environment. Thereafter is the thesis focused on determining equations for dependences of RiIG distribution parameters on known concentrations of contrast agent for ultrasonic data captured in vitro. These equations are useful for determining the unknown concentration of contrast agent used in images captured in vivo and making its dilution function.
